Push-pull exercises, or isometric training, use your hands against a stationary object or each other to work out and slightly stretch particular muscle groups. It is said that this causes the affected areas to gain more strength and endurance. Isometric is another name for this idea.
The term "exercise" refers, in the broadest sense, to any time spent moving around with the goal of improving one's health and fitness. Numerous techniques, such as various muscle contractions, can be used to carry out this physical activity. Isometric and isotonic muscle contractions are the most typical in humans.
